The influence of occupational stress factors on the nicotine dependence: a cross sectional study

Anna Schmidt, Melanie Neumann, Markus Wirtz, Nicole Ernstmann, Andrea Staratschek-Jox, Erich Stoelben, Jürgen Wolf, Holger Pfaff Tobacco Induced Diseases 2010, 8:6 (13 April 2010)

Abstract | Full text | PDF | PubMed |  Editor’s summary

German study finds higher workplace stress levels are not linked to higher nicotine dependence levels possibly as a result of smoking bans and greater workloads reducing the opportunities for cigarette breaks.

Smoking status in relation to serum folate and dietary vitamin intake

Constantine I Vardavas, Manolis K Linardakis, Christos M Hatzis, Niki Malliaraki, Wim HM Saris, Anthony G Kafatos Tobacco Induced Diseases 2008, 4:8 (9 September 2008)

Abstract | Full text | PDF | PubMed | Cited on BioMed Central |  Editor’s summary

Smokers may have lowered dietary micronutrient intake and reduced serum folate levels, both of which can act as risk factors predisposing them to tobacco related illnesses such as cardiovascular disease.
